Transaction 891947291b9b3cbde852525fd72efa13f5fc3bfe23d398b17e729c5e2f279d7a
1 Input
1 Output
-
891947291b9b3cbde852525fd72efa13f5fc3bfe23d398b17e729c5e2f279d7a:0
- value
- 594937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f1706940f2b341e6d8db4da46ce931204e848af OP_EQUAL
- address
- 37Sc5UwU11bx71oambNasLFafj1YATRYj5